Woman seeks protection from errant neighbours

G. Kaliammal, resident of Ondipudur, has submitted a petition to the District Collector about her neighbours who were allegedly indulging in prostitution and other illicit activities.

In the petition Kaliammal has said that Mr. Vinodkumar had been staying on rent from February 12, 2015. His relatives had been behaving suspiciously. Women and men were visiting the house at midnight and were making too much noise.

When she had a doubt that prostitution and other illicit activities were going on, she and other neighbours confronted to Vinodkumar. He was asked to vacate the house. But he did not do so, and continued to reside there without paying rent. A court case pertaining to this was going on in the Civil Court since July 20, 2015.

Vinodkumar had also used foul language to abuse Kaliammal. She has also mentioned in the petition that she had given a complaint at the B-5 Singanallur Police Station. But they had dismissed the complaint pointing out that it was a civil issue and hence could not be handled by them. So, as a last resort she had approached the Collector seeking protection for her family and also urging her to take strict action against the B-5 police.
